If you search online, you’ll find countless benchmarks claiming to compare the performance of various JavaScript frameworks with each other. More often than not, the benchmarks are overly simplistic and fail to reflect real-world scenarios. In other cases, they compare apples and oranges, for instance by pitting a fully fledged framework against a lightweight library that cover only a small subset of the framework’s functionality.
